I have calcium level of 10.3, albumin level of 5.1, is the calcium high? i'm 22

No, it's normal.: The level of calcium in the blood moves up and down with albumin, so your calcium is normal. The albumin level is higher than usual, most likely reflecting mild dehydration. Have a salty meal and drink water and this should correct.
